For the 3 judges to give it Dawson by 4 rounds each was an absolute disgrace. IMO Johnson clearly won the last 3 rounds, so are we to believe that Bad Chad was ahead by 7 points going into round 10?
I guess that promoter Gary Shaw's future plans for Dawson-Tarver had nothing to do with such an outrageous decision. I guess a grizzled old vet like Johnson just didn't fit in.
I myself am not 100% certain that Johnson won(I had it 115-114 Johnson), you could certainly make an honest case for Dawson to win but to say there were 4 rounds difference is shocking, truly shocking.
As for Woods-Tarver, as a Brit myself, i was truly disappointed. I thought that Woods could pull out a big win against a marketable name but i was wrong. He never got to grips with The Magic Man. I hate to say it but Tarver was too good. When's the last time he put in a performance like that?
For me, it was maybe even a better performance than the Jones fights.
Clinton Woods is no bum but Tarver made him look very ordinary indeed. Even though i don't like the guy, i have to take my hat off to Tarver. He's definitely back in the mix now.
Good COmments re the scoring, the closer rounds come down to how you appreciate a certain style of fighting, the Johnson Dawson fight appeared to be a round one way or the other depending on how much weight you gave to the man coming forward vs the man boxing well on the retreat, in either case there was not thrr or four rounds daylight.
As I have said before, it was rather ironic that the English Judge (from Woods's own county, not just Country) gave it to Tarver by the most realistic margin on the basis of actual punches landed, the other guys seem to give closer rounds to woods by merit of him going forward and leading with his faceComment
